3 Killed in Fatal Collision Between Van and Cargo Truck

Three individuals lost their lives in a tragic collision between a passenger van and a cargo truck in Sitio Bulotano, Barangay Lantay, Pangantucan, Bukidnon, yesterday afternoon.

The victims were identified as Sonia Bangit, 47; a young girl passenger; and van driver Argon Bangit, 58, all residents of Barangay Barandias in Pangantucan.

The truck driver, Bryan Benachay of Barangay Adtuyon, and a 20-year-old passenger, Sayson Alquizar, sustained injuries in the crash.

Initial investigation revealed that the truck, loaded with sugarcane and en route from Maramag to Kalilangan, lost its brakes, causing it to crash into the passenger van and fall off a high bridge.

The truck driver, Benachay, is now detained at the Pangantucan Police Station as authorities prepare the necessary documents for filing charges against him.
